Sunday Wind and 84 Degree Heat

Chicago, you felt that wind today. Gusts hitting thirty miles per hour, temperatures pushing up near eighty-four degrees.

Small Craft Advisory Lake Michigan

Before we get to the storms, let's talk about the lake. Lake Michigan is under a Small Craft Advisory right now because of those same winds driving Sunday's breezy conditions.
